New Hampshire Motor Speedway is a 1.058-mile flat D-oval nicknamed The Magic Mile, where short-track aggression and superspeedway strategy combine to create one of NASCAR’s most unpredictable races on iRacing.
iRacing Released: June 2009
Opened: 1990
Track Length: 1.058 mi (1.703 km)
Configurations: 1
Location: 🇺🇸 Loudon, New Hampshire
The only NASCAR Cup Series track in New England, New Hampshire is known for its flat corners and the premium it places on mechanical grip.
